Software Engineer

Company:  Veris Global
Location: Lafayette
Closing Date: 23/10/2024
Hours: Full Time
Type: Permanent
Job Requirements / Description

Job Title: Software Engineer (Angular, .NET, SQL, Azure)


Reports To: Director of Software


Location: Lafayette, LA


About Veris Global:

Veris Global is on the lookout for a talented and driven Software Engineer to join our innovative team. We thrive on building solutions that make a difference and are looking for someone who is passionate about crafting high-quality software using Angular, .NET, SQL, and Azure. This is your opportunity to contribute to impactful projects in a collaborative and fast-paced environment, where your work directly influences the success of our clients and organization.


Role Overview:

As a Software Engineer, you will be at the heart of our development efforts—designing, building, and maintaining software applications that solve real-world problems. You will work closely with cross-functional teams to transform user requirements into robust, scalable solutions. Your role will involve the full software development life cycle (SDLC), from concept to deployment, with an emphasis on delivering innovative and efficient systems that meet user needs.



Key Responsibilities:

  • Lead the development of software solutions using Angular, .NET, SQL, and Azure technologies.
  • Collaborate with stakeholders to gather requirements, define system functionality, and create effective solutions.
  • Develop well-structured, testable, and efficient code that adheres to best practices and coding standards.
  • Create and maintain comprehensive documentation for requirements, system architecture, and software functionality.
  • Integrate software components into complete, fully functional systems.
  • Design and execute software verification plans, ensuring quality and reliability.
  • Troubleshoot, debug, and enhance existing systems to optimize performance and address evolving needs.
  • Develop solutions for fast-moving problems, providing real-time implementation and support.
  • Deploy software programs, gather user feedback, and iterate to improve usability and performance.
  • Adhere to project plans, timelines, and industry standards while contributing to a culture of innovation.
  • Stay informed of emerging trends, tools, and best practices in software development.


Qualifications:

  • Proven experience as a Software Engineer or Software Developer, with a focus on Angular, .NET, SQL, and Azure.
  • Strong expertise in designing and developing interactive applications.
  • Proficient in C#, C++, Java, Python, or similar programming languages.
  • In-depth understanding of relational databases, SQL, and ORM technologies such as Entity Framework Core.
  • Experience developing web applications using popular frameworks, such as Angular or React.
  • Familiarity with Agile development methodologies.
  • Skilled in using software engineering tools and version control systems, particularly Git.
  • Strong communication skills, with a focus on documenting requirements and specifications.
  • Bachelor’s degree in Computer Science, Engineering, or a related field.

Why Join Us?

At Veris Global, we are committed to fostering a supportive and innovative environment. We believe in nurturing talent and providing opportunities for growth and learning. If you’re excited by the idea of tackling challenging projects and contributing to meaningful software solutions, we’d love to hear from you.

Apply Now
Share this job
Veris Global
  • Similar Jobs

  • Mid Level to Senior Software Engineer

    Lafayette
    View Job
  • Reliability Engineer

    Lafayette
    View Job
  • Reliability Engineer

    Lafayette
    View Job
  • Electrical Engineer

    Lafayette
    View Job
  • Control Engineer

    Lafayette
    View Job
An error has occurred. This application may no longer respond until reloaded. Reload 🗙